I don’t know why it would be difficult to travel to other parks if you have Park Hopper, especially the monorail to Epcot. However, I would imagine those other parks may be busier in the evening due to the fact MK will not be open.

If you use LL and maybe an ILL for Guardians, and want to do one meal at Epcot, I think it’s realistic. However Epcot closes at 9 so I wouldn’t necessarily wait until 6pm when MK closes to do your hop. I normally don’t do LL for Epcot unless it’s on a park hopper day, because usually the lines are not that terrible to wait to begin with, other than Remi, Frozen and GOG

Looking for radiation pro tips! by Spiritual-Fun-2682 in breastcancer

[–]faithdevilsb 0 points1 point  (0 children)

So, just here as the cautionary tale:

If you have a lanolin (wool) allergy, please do NOT use aquaphor. Even if you’ve successfully used aquaphor in the past. Also, If you have seasonal allergies especially to ragweed, do NOT use Calendula cream.

I unfortunately found out the hard way with both of these that I was allergic. My boob is actually being published in a medical journal regarding the aquaphor situation 😂

So, all that said, I was able to use aloe and Vanicream to keep the area moisturized. I was told specifically not to use hydrocortisone creams because the steroids in the cream can make your skin more susceptible to infection during treatment.
